Hi StrontiumSteel thanks, yeah your colour scheme which i believe is 95 red, white, blue, black with the hand rail red, was my original choice but I opted for the 96/97 maroon,black,grey and white with black handle bar. which i thought was classier. The standard honda stickers is Air brushed ie ones one the tank, CBR on the side, 1000F at the back (but I made the 1000f slightly smaller) coz i think it will look better. I bought the frame sliders from a shop called Regina in Singapore from one of my trips. there is a email address ie daveglo94@yahoo.com.sg (tel +65 6295 5449 fax +65 6295 5433) I don't think they have a website. They are standard frame sliders that can fit on most bikes. I got these "mushrooms" because they are a little longer than usual.
